Regular Season Round 11: Kolossos - AGOR 93-90 OT
Date: January 4, 2012
Fifth-ranked AGOR (5-5) was very close to win a game against third ranked Kolossos (9-1) in Rodou on Wednesday. Kolossos managed to secure only three-point victory 93-90. However their fans expected easier game. The hosts trailed by 3 points at the halftime before their 23-19 charge in the third quarter, which allowed them to tie the game at the end of regular time. They were better in overtime eventually winning that period 20-17. Kolossos shot 35 for 47 from the free-throw line, while AGOR only scored fourteen points from the stripe. AGOR was plagued by 33 personal fouls down the stretch. American guard Marcus Hatten (186-80, college: St.John's) orchestrated the victory by scoring 27 points and 7 rebounds. His fellow American import forward Ruben Boykin (201-85, college: N.Arizona) contributed with 19 points and 8 rebounds for the winners. Four Kolossos players scored in double figures. American guard Dionte Christmas (196-86, college: Temple) answered with 25 points and 5 rebounds and the former international forward Giorgos Dedas (200-80) added 13 points in the effort for AGOR. Both coaches used bench players in such tough game. Kolossos have an impressive series of five victories in a row. They keep a position of league leader, which they share with Panathinaikos and Olympiakos. Newly promoted AGOR keeps the fifth place with five games lost. Kolossos will face Peristeri GS (#6) in Athens in the next round which should be theoretically an easy game. AGOR will play at home against Aris in Thessaloniki.
Top scorers:
Kolossos: M.Hatten 27+7reb+3ast, R.Boykin 19+8reb+1ast, S.Hopson 15+6reb+2ast, A.Tsamis 14+7reb+3ast, A.Asimakopoulos 7+6reb, G.Georgalis 5+1reb
AGOR: D.Christmas 25+5reb+1ast, G.Dedas 13+2reb+1ast, D.Latovic 11+3reb, Z.Wright 10+5reb, A.Tsochlas 9+3reb+3ast, N.Papanikolaou 9+6reb+1ast
